Tactical Synergy and Squad Coordination Analysis

As Manchester City and Barcelona prepare for their high-profile Club Friendly on July 30, both managers are focusing heavily on tactical coordination and integrating youth academy products with established first-team stars.

For Manchester City, Pep Guardiola has spent the early part of the pre-season drilling positional fluidity. The coordination between midfield progressors like Mateo Kovačić and emerging playmaker James McAtee has shown immense promise. Erling Haaland’s chemistry with Oscar Bobb on the right flank has developed rapidly, characterized by quick combination play and blind-side runs. However, because several key starters are still resting post-Euros, the defensive line suffers from a lack of structural cohesion, occasionally leaving huge gaps during defensive transitions.

Barcelona, under the newly appointed Hansi Flick, are showcasing a shift toward a more direct, high-pressing 4-2-3-1 system. The on-pitch understanding between veterans like Robert Lewandowski and youngsters such as Pablo Torre and Marc Casadó is in its developmental stage but exhibits high verticality. Flick’s emphasis on counter-pressing requires tight spatial coordination. While the forward line coordinates well to force turnovers, the coordination between the midfield double-pivot and the backline remains vulnerable to quick, switching long balls.


Offensive and Defensive Capabilities

Manchester City

  • Offensive Power: Exceptional. With Erling Haaland spearheading the attack, supported by Jack Grealish and Oscar Bobb, City possesses world-class wing play and lethal finishing. Their ability to overload the half-spaces remains unmatched, even in pre-season.
  • Defensive Stability: Moderate to Low. Due to the absence of key defensive anchors like Ruben Dias and Rodri, City's rest defense has looked shaky. They are prone to conceding high-quality chances on counter-attacks, particularly down the channels.

Barcelona

  • Offensive Power: High. Hansi Flick’s tactical blueprint demands rapid transition forward. Robert Lewandowski remains a lethal target man, while Vitor Roque and Alejandro Balde provide explosive pace on the flanks to stretch opposing low blocks.
  • Defensive Stability: Moderate. Barcelona is deploying a very high defensive line. While this pressure can suffocate opponents, it exposes their central defenders to balls played over the top, especially against a team with the passing vision of Manchester City.

Player Physical Fitness & Conditioning Status

Physical conditioning is the defining variable of this July 30 fixture. Both squads are in different phases of their pre-season fitness programs:

  • Manchester City: Players who joined the US tour early, such as Haaland, Grealish, and Kalvin Phillips, have achieved near-optimal match fitness. However, the younger squad rotation players are still adjusting to the high-intensity pressing demands, leading to visible second-half fatigue.
  • Barcelona: Hansi Flick’s notorious physical conditioning regime is already underway. While the squad boasts high stamina, heavy legs are expected due to double training sessions in the days leading up to the match. Key players returning from international duty are being eased back with capped 45-minute appearances to prevent muscular injuries.

Precise Score Prediction

Considering the pre-season context, both teams are heavily prioritized on offensive patterns rather than defensive solidity. Manchester City’s attacking fluency led by Haaland will undoubtedly exploit Barcelona’s high line. Conversely, Barcelona’s aggressive counter-press under Flick will capitalize on a makeshift Manchester City defense still searching for its rhythm.

Because friendly matches prioritize squad rotation, tactical experimentation, and entertaining football over pragmatic defending, we anticipate a high-scoring, open encounter. Both teams will have dominant spells, but defensive lapses due to fatigue and substitutions in the second half will level the playing field.

Precise Predicted Score: Manchester City 2-2 Barcelona
